Hi, folks on the list -- Regarding the films which Shirley <arabin@wave.co.nz> referred to on 19 Jly and again on 23 Jly -- ie. LDS films # 0990356, # 0990357, and # 0990358 -- others besides Jeremy <truffle@cix.co.uk> may also be wondering what the exact contents of these filmed volumes are. Unfortunately and frustratingly, the LDS web site (www.familysearch.org) does not explain or itemize the film contents other than to say they include the Proceedings (which Shirley had already told us). The Proceedings are apparently a series of publications which contain a great variety of information, on many subjects (as opposed to the Quarto series, which tends to be mostly church records). Both were published by the Huguenot Society of London (now Hug. Soc. of Great Britain and Ireland). I will try contacting Mr. Massil, the Librarian at the Hug. Soc. Library in London, to see if he can supply details as to what is in each volume of the Proceedings and will post to the list when I receive his reply.
